What can I see and do near Ioannis Sykoutris Library?
You'll want to browse the collections at Benaki Museum, Technopolis, and Museum of Cycladic Art. Sights like Acropolis, Roman Agora, and Parthenon are must-sees while exploring the area. You can watch performances at Odeon of Herodes Atticus, Athens Concert Hall, and Olympia Theatre if you're interested in local theater.
How can I get to Ioannis Sykoutris Library?
With so many ways to get around, exploring the area around Ioannis Sykoutris Library is simple. Nearby metro stations include Panepistimio Station, Syntagma Station, and Omonoia Station. If you're taking a train to the area, Athens Central Station is the closest stop to Athens City Centre.
